Sun exposure in Lodi is essentially solid. On a common year, solar installation company the region sees approximately 5 to 6 height sun hours each day when averaged throughout periods, which places it near the pleasant area for household solar. That claimed, the Central Valley has a few peculiarities that good solar panel installers account for.
First, summer warmth. Panels lose some effectiveness as temperature levels climb. High quality components with reduced temperature coefficients help, and a racking format that motivates airflow under the panel backsheet can recover a couple of percent of performance during August warm waves.
Second, air high quality and dirt. Harvest dust and wildfire smoke can cut production during brief windows. Panels rarely require monthly cleansing here, however a light rinse 2 or three times a year, or after a significant smoke event, pays back quickly. Installers that construct in secure upkeep gain access to and show you a straightforward cleansing plan save migraines later.
Third, color from fully grown trees. Lots of Lodi neighborhoods have stunning valley oaks. A strong layout make up seasonal color and makes use of component level power electronics, either microinverters or DC optimizers, to keep shaded panels from dragging down the whole array.
Finally, roof coverings. Composition shingle prevails, but so are tile roof coverings on more recent homes. A careful floor tile mounting method, with hooks that replace ceramic tiles and keep waterproofing, divides specialists from crews that break floor tiles and leave leak factors. If you have a standing seam metal roofing system on a barn, try to find installers comfortable with non permeating clamps, which preserve the roof covering warranty and speed up the photovoltaic panel install.
Utility policy drives solar economics as high as sunlight. The majority of addresses in San Joaquin County attach to PG&E, but lots of within Lodi city restrictions are served by Lodi Electric Utility. These are different globes in regards to tolls and crediting.
PG&& E moved to Web Payment under The golden state's NEM 3.0 framework. Exported solar power makes credits based on hourly stayed clear of cost rates, not retail prices, which highly motivates self intake and makes batteries important. A regular house system without a battery still saves, however the system style often turns production towards noontime self usage, for instance with lots moving for air conditioning, EV charging, or pool pumps.
Lodi Electric Energy has its very own policies. Metropolitan utilities do not always mirror PG&E's policies. Some provide standard web metering at a set rate, some offer regular monthly credit histories that work out every year, and some follow a net billing framework with lower export worths. The only safe relocation is to ask your installer to show you the existing tariff sheets from your utility and to model manufacturing hour by hour under those guidelines. The best solar setup firms near me placed the tariff name, export presumptions, and escalation rate in the proposition so there are no surprises.
California maintains the 30 percent federal Financial investment Tax obligation Credit score in play, which applies to solar panel installment, inverters, racking, required solution upgrades, and additionally to energy storage space that is billed by the system. State incentives change more often, yet two attract attention. The Self Generation Motivation Program has discounts for batteries that can pile with the tax obligation credit rating, and the state's energetic solar power system property tax exemption can prevent the assessed worth of a certifying solar energy setup from boosting your real estate tax. Constantly validate current incentive details with your tax obligation advisor or the county assessor, given that days and quantities evolve.
Top solar firms share a couple of routines. They bring a ladder and an electronic camera, they measure attic rooms, they note the age and kind of underlayment, and they check service panels for ability. They do not presume. They also reveal you a twelve month energy use profile, not simply a yearly sum, because a home with hefty summertime air conditioning needs a various inverter and battery technique than a home with stable all season loads.
A clean proposition consists of component brand and wattage, inverter type, stringing plan if relevant, overall system dimension in kW DC and kW air conditioning, production quotes by month, and a guarantee matrix. It also specifies the roofing penetration count, flashing kind, and any type of architectural upgrades. On ceramic tile roofs, I anticipate to see the amount of floor tiles will certainly be changed versus ground, and what substitute tile SGIP battery rebate California or blinking system is planned. If shade residential solar panels Lodi differs across your range, component degree electronics are non negotiable. Microinverters position an inverter behind every panel, providing you panel by panel surveillance and strength. A DC string inverter with power optimizers additionally keeps an eye on per component and lets each panel run at its very own optimum power point. Either can be exceptional when combined correctly.
Microinverters radiate on intricate roofings with many small planes, or where future expansion is likely, given that each panel is independent on the a/c side. Enhanced string systems typically lug greater max power and can be affordable on larger arrays with longer strings. Both techniques fulfill present quick shutdown code needs. The right choice relies on your roof covering, future battery plans, and the installer's solution bench. Ask which platform their teams understand best, not just what the sales representative prefers.
Under PG&E's net invoicing, batteries are not a high-end, they are the key to strong savings because they let you store midday solar and utilize it throughout high priced night hours. In Lodi Electric territory, the situation differs by toll. Also if your utility credit histories exports well, batteries include outage security, which matters when summer storms or PSPS events interrupt service.
A common home sets a 7 to 13 kWh battery with a 6 to 10 kW solar array. That provides concerning one evening of normal use, or several nights if you enable the system to handle loads, for instance by slowing swimming pool pumps and setting a clever thermostat to economic climate mode throughout blackouts. For rural homes with wells, step very carefully. Pump motors have high starting currents, so you will certainly want an installer who can determine secured blades amps and size the battery inverter to take care of those rises without hassle trips.
I get asked whether it makes sense to reroof initially. If your roofing system has less than 8 to 10 years of life left, replace that area prior to the photovoltaic panel mount. Removing and reinstalling solar later costs cash and risks damages. On tile, the underlayment is the weak link. If it is weak or curling, have the roofer manage underlayment replacement at the same time the solar crew installs standoffs. The most effective solar installers Lodi house owners recommend often tend to have limited partnerships with neighborhood roofing teams for this reason.
On flat foam roof coverings, ballasted systems are possible, but in quake country I choose mechanical attachments that are secured appropriately. The included work upfront avoids motion and maintains guarantees clean.
California structure divisions are quickly by nationwide requirements, and some jurisdictions use the SolarAPP+ program for exact same day allows on basic layouts. Whether the City of Lodi participates can transform, so your service provider ought to validate. Regardless, fire code requires roofing system access paths and setbacks near ridges and hips. Expect a clear three foot pathway from ridge to eave on a minimum of one roof covering face and problems between varieties and ridges or hips. A staff that makes for code from the beginning prevents area changes when the inspector walks the roof.
Main circuit box upgrades are common on older homes with 100 amp solution. Upgrading to 200 amps can cost a couple of thousand dollars and may need energy sychronisation. Great propositions call this out early, with line thing rates, so you can budget accurately.
Two numbers have to be clear in any kind of solar proposition. System dimension in kW DC and anticipated annual output solar maintenance and warranty in kWh. A common Lodi solitary family home winds up with 6 to 10 kW of panels, producing about 9,000 to 14,000 kWh annually depending on orientation and shading. South and west roofs execute ideal provided neighborhood time of usage rates, with west facing selections making a little less overall power however even more during the high worth late mid-day window.
Degradation issues too. Panels shed output gradually over time, typically 0.25 to 0.5 percent annually on reputable components. Demand an efficiency guarantee that ensures a minimum of 80 to 85 percent of initial result at year 25. Keep in mind that the performance service warranty is only as strong as the firm behind it. Bankable brand names are worth a small costs due to the fact that they will certainly still be around to honor claims.

Cash purchases deliver the very best life time economics due to the fact that you avoid passion. That said, several home owners use loans. A fair solar finance has a clear APR, no large dealer fee buried in the cost, and no balloon payment set off by the tax credit. If a proposition reveals a reduced regular monthly repayment that assumes you will use the 30 percent tax credit scores as a lump sum within a year, make sure that strategy fits your real tax scenario. For organizations and ranches, devaluation can include significant worth, and some agricultural consumers in the area package solar with pump upgrades, which can open additional rebates.
Leases and power acquisition contracts still exist, however they complicate residential property sales and decrease control. I only suggest them when a customer can not record the tax credit or desires a 3rd party to own and preserve the system for a specific reason.

A house owner off Kettleman Lane had a west dealing with main roof covering and a small south dormer. Their summertime bills ran high due to a late mid-day cooling down lots. We utilized twelve high efficiency modules on the west plane and 4 on the south dormer with microinverters to keep checking tidy. Including a moderate 10 kWh battery moved fifty percent of the lunchtime production into the 4 to 9 pm window, and the payback reduced by well over a year contrasted to the exact same selection without storage space under net billing.
Another instance, a floor tile roofing system near Lodi Lake with patchy oak shade. The owner desired the appearance of also rows, yet the color version showed heavy morning loss on the lower eastern tiles. We reduced two rows, raised the variety greater on the roofing system, opened up bigger paths for fire code, and selected a module with a split cell design that keeps current moving around partial shade. Annual outcome hardly changed contrasted to the bigger, lower layout, and upkeep access improved.
On a tiny vineyard outbuilding, a standing joint metal roof let us make use of non passing through clamps. The team linked the avenue run under the ridge cap, so no open penetrations interrupted the roof. That added an hour to the mount yet preserved the roofing service warranty and maintained weatherproofing simple.
Every modern-day system consists of a tracking app. It is useful, but do not obsess over daily variants. Enjoy monthly fads. If you notice a consistent decline not linked to periods, call your installer prior to the service warranty home window on labor runs out. Yearly or semiannual rinsing with deionized water maintains mineral spotting down. Avoid unpleasant brushes, which can scratch glass and space warranties.
Critter guards are clever near vineyards and in neighborhoods with energetic bird populations. A low profile fit together around the module borders maintains starlings from nesting under panels, which lowers debris accumulation and fire danger. If your home backs to fields, request stainless bolts on guards, which outlast repainted moderate steel in dusty, sometimes wet conditions.
National solar panel companies lug purchasing power and sleek procedures. You may obtain a little better prices on components or batteries. They also have a tendency to have solid financing collaborations. The trade off can be versatility. If your roofing system needs a custom-made rack, a service pole moving, or a specialized ceramic tile, a neighborhood crew that buys from several distributors often adjusts much faster. Service warranty service is the other angle. A national service queue can mean weeks of waiting during optimal period. A neighborhood shop that mounted your selection often obtains you back on-line faster.
An excellent path in Lodi is to gather at the very least one proposal from a nationwide firm and a couple of from regional solar installers Lodi home owners examine positively. Compare the layouts alongside. If the regional layout reveals better roofing system fit, more powerful electrical details, and a clear battery technique under your precise toll, a tiny price delta is generally worth it.
Crews get here with two teams, a roofing system team and a ground group. The roofing system team actions and snaps chalk lines, locates rafters, and establishes standoffs with flashed infiltrations. Rails increase, after that optimizers or microinverter joints, after that the components. On ceramic tile, expect floor tile substitute or grinding to fit hooks. Done right, you will see mindful tile handling and substitute with color matched pieces.
On the ground, the electrician places the inverter and any battery cabinet on a code compliant wall surface with clear functioning space. Conduit runs stay limited to structure lines and stay clear of awful crossovers. Identifying is accurate. By mid mid-day, the system is mechanically total. Commissioning waits for utility authorization, which can take days to a number of weeks relying on the energy and the season.
Permitting, energy affiliation, and supply chain drive timelines greater than labor. In Lodi, a clean property job commonly runs four to eight weeks from signature to approval to operate. If a primary panel upgrade is needed, include a week or more. Battery backorders can extend timelines in peak months. Clear interaction from your installer matters most right here. A regular update, also if the message is we are still waiting on the utility, builds trust.

Selling a home with solar panels can be complicated when systems are leased or financed. Buyers may need to assume payments or qualify for transfer agreements. Owned systems are generally easier to transfer but still require documentation. Misunderstanding contract terms can also slow down the sale process.

A house can run fully on solar power if the system is properly sized and paired with battery storage. Energy production must match or exceed household consumption over time. Grid connection is often used as backup during low sunlight periods. System design and energy efficiency play a major role in full solar independence.
